Geological drilling pipes
- Outer diameter: Φ33mm~Φ127mm
- Wall thickness: 5.0mm~10.0mm
- Length: 6.0m~12.0m
- Grades: ZT380、ZT 490、ZT 520、ZT 540、ZT 590、ZT 640、ZT 740
Drill pipe is a component connecting the drilling machine and the drill bit, transmitting the power to break the rock in the hole and transporting rinse agent.
Standards:
GB/T 9808-2008 : Seamless Steel Tubes for Drilling
JIS G 3465-2006 : Seamless Steel Tubes for Drilling
GB/T 16950-2014 : Geological Core Drilling Tools
Mechanical properties:
Grade | Yield strength (Rp0.2/MPa) | Tensile strength (Rm/MPa) | Elongation A/% |
ZT380 | ≥380 | ≥640 | ≥14 |
ZT490 | ≥490 | ≥690 | ≥12 |
ZT520 | ≥520a | ≥780 | ≥15b |
ZT540 | ≥540 | ≥740 | ≥12 |
ZT590 | ≥590 | ≥770 | ≥12 |
ZT640 | ≥640 | ≥790 | ≥12 |
ZT740 | ≥740 | ≥840 | ≥10 |
Remarks: 1. Yield strength of Grade ZT520 is measured by Rp0.5 . 2. Tensile specimens of Grade ZT520 adopt S4, S5 or S6 according to GB/T228. | |||
Outer diameter tolerance: -0.5%D~+1.0%D
Wall thickness tolerance: -10%S~+12.5%S
Straightness: ≤1.0~1.3mm/m
